自死亡估计以来的时间内低温性败血症 - 一个病例报告
Stefan Potente1, Victoria Hanser2, Sara Heinbuch2
1Department of Legal Medicine, University of Saarland Medical School, Homburg/Saar, Germany. stefan.potente@uni-saarland.de.
International journal of legal medicine
|February 20, 2024
概括
低温症使法医估计死亡时间变得复杂. 虽然可以检测到低体温,但适应低温病例的标准方程是不可靠的,应避免在法医调查中使用.

背景情况:
- 基于温度的法医时间,因为死亡估计受到高温和低温的挑战.
- 低温可能与暴露或败血症有关,这在法医背景下很重要.
- 败血症可能伴随着低温,使死后间隔评估复杂化.
研究的目的:
- 为了调查一个低温和死亡估计时间相冲突的案例.
- 评估基于温度的方法在低温死亡场景中的适用性.
- 评估适用于低温病例的适应死后间隔方程的可靠性.
主要方法:
- 一个囚犯在监狱牢房中被发现死亡的案例研究.
- 使用温度计和记录器进行直肠温度测量.
- 将PRISM方法应用于温度记录.
- 尸体解剖以确定死亡原因 (败血器官衰竭).
- 审查摄像机录制的记录,以证实时间线.
主要成果:
- 在高环境温度下记录了低直肠温度,这表明死后间隔较长.
- 摄像机的录像证实了看守的时间表,与最初基于温度的估计相矛盾.
- 尸体解剖证实了败血性器官衰竭是死亡的原因,解释了低温.
- 在死亡时,PRISM方法成功检测到低温.
- 将PRISM方程调整为较低的起始温度产生了不满意的结果.
结论:
- 死亡时的低温可以使用温度数据检测到.
- 不建议对低温病例的死亡估计方程进行标准时间的调整.
- 准确的死亡时间估计需要考虑所有可用的证据,包括非基于温度的数据.

A decreased body temperature can occur in patients with hypothermia and frostbite. Heat loss with extended cold exposure overpowers the body's ability to create heat, resulting in hypothermia. Core temperature readings help classify hypothermia. Mild hypothermia is temperatures between 32 °C (89.6 °F) and 35°C (95 °F) and is caused by impaired thermoregulation.
